New Chief Named

Waterloo has named a new Police Chief after former Chief, Joe Leibold, retired last week, according to the Waterloo Cedar Falls Courier. Rob Duncan, who was born and raised in Waterloo, will take over the top spot. The move will need to be approved by the City Council at their next meeting on July 1st. Duncan started with the Waterloo Police Department in 1997 and was promoted to Captain in 2021. He has an associate’s degree in Criminal Justice from Gateway Community College and was named Waterloo Police Officer of the Year in 2004. He serves on the boards of the Human Rights Commission as a liaison, Child Protection Center at Allen Hospital, and the executive board of the Waterloo Police Protective Association.
